This unit

The RTD Embedded Technologies DM6430HR-1 is a PC/104 form factor data acquisition module delivering 16-bit analog I/O with full AT bus interface and DMA support. It captures analog signals at 100 kHz with 10 µs conversion time, processes up to 16 single-ended or 8 differential input channels across ±10V range, and generates two 16-bit analog outputs. The module integrates programmable digital I/O, dual 16-bit timer/counters, and an 8 MHz on-board clock for precise timing and synchronization in embedded systems.


Technical Specifications

Analog Input

  • 16-bit resolution, 100 kHz sampling rate, 10 µs conversion time

  • 16 single-ended or 8 differential channels

  • ±10V input range with programmable gains of 1, 2, 4, and 8

  • 1024 × 24-entry channel-gain scan memory with skip bit

  • 1024-sample A/D buffer supporting gap-free acquisition

  • Software, pacer clock, and external trigger modes with pre-trigger, post-trigger, and about-trigger capabilities

  • Random scan, burst, and multi-burst scan modes

  • ±12V overvoltage protection; ±10V common-mode input voltage (differential) Analog Output

  • 2 channels, 16-bit resolution

  • ±10V output range, 10 µs settling time (full scale)

  • 5 mA output current Digital I/O

  • 1 KB input buffer

  • Port 0: 8 bit-programmable lines; Port 1: 8-bit programmable port

  • Event interrupt (any bit change) and match interrupt modes

  • Output drive: −12/+24 mA Timers and Counters

  • Programmable high-speed sample counter

  • Two 16-bit timer/counters

  • 8 MHz on-board clock Interfaces & Physical

  • Full AT bus interface (PC/104 stackable ISA); DMA transfers supported

  • 3.775 × 3.550 inches, 0.600-inch standoff height; 0.34 lbs

Compatibility & Integration Software support includes DOS, Windows (98, NT4.0, 2000, XP/XPe), and Linux (2.4.x, 2.6.x) with source code provided. Compatible with LabVIEW and MATLAB toolkits through Windows drivers.
